III. Buda Castle Beer Festival

Monday, 17 June 2013 00:00 Sylvia We were there
Print PDF

The Buda Castle was filled up with beer again, for the third time: the 3rd Budapest Beer Festival welcomed visitors on June 13-16, 2013 offering almost 200 different beers both from Hungary and abroad, including home brewed beauties. You could enjoy the „liquid bread” of Germany, Belgium, Holland, Czech, Slovakia, UK and Denmark – as well as ciders. The Balkan garden put a spell on you with gipsy music, guitars hanging in the air. Felt like trying banana or chocolate tasting beer? This was the time than ... while enjoying the true street carnival atmosphere, with concerts of Charlie, Ganxta Zolee, Mystery Gang, ZUP, Balkan Fanatik, the Joe Cocker, Doors and ZZ Top tribute bands. PARK - Opening Party

Sunday, 16 June 2013 14:33 Sylvia We were there
Print PDF

PARK Opened the Summer Season with a Grand Event: Hungarian band Tankcsapda farewell concert in Budapest, before they start their 1 year tour in the countryside. The concert was staged by Soproni Brewery, featuring their new alcohol-free beer, the Soproni Szűz (Sopron Virgin). PARK just starts its summer season though, offering great fun for rock lovers, housing even 8 thousand fans.

OTP Bank Equestrian World Cup

Monday, 03 December 2012 00:00 Sylvia We were there
Print PDF

The OTP Equestrian World Cup was organized in the Budapest Sport Arena. The event is fully booked each year. This year already for the 6th time, the most well known horse carriage drivers, the Lázár brothers organized the horse championship in Budapest. Just like before, the event attracted the very best of the world to Hungary again. Not only is this a sport event, but also a social and family event. Budapest Fashion Nights - Art'z Modell Fashion Show

Monday, 19 November 2012 20:37 Sylvia We were there
Print PDF

The 11th Budapest Fashion Night event was organised in the autumn of 2012. The series raises awareness about Hungarian fashion – this time presenting collections of Art’z Modell, celebrating its 25th birthday on October 30.

The fashion event launched by Bloom Fashion Group – supporting Hungarian fashion, coupled with a fancy fashion party – was a great success also this year.

Sweet Days in Buda Castle

Sunday, 23 September 2012 14:05 Sylvia We were there
Print PDF

The open air Chocolate and Sweets Festival took place in the Buda Castle. Hundreds of sweets lover visitors arrived to taste every kind of cocoa products. Multinational companies, chocolate craftsmen, producers and traders from Hungary and abroad were attending the Chocolate and Sweets Festival to tempt you with their delicacies. Fruits, seeds, coffee, vanilla, various syrups, honey, fine wines and sweet drinks accompanied the chocolate and sweets at the festival. The festival also offered kid-friendly programs to keep the little ones entertained while grown-ups participated at chocolate-manufacturing courses. If you were not tired of tasting sweets all day long, you could enjoy live concerts accompanied by fine wines in the evening. Topping the event, finally the queen of all sweet girls, the Cherry Queen was also elected on the stage. Sweet memories...
